Nancy I. Blaisdell
October 28, 2001
Nancy Irene Blaisdell, 63, of 90 Bachand Ave. died Sunday at home.
Born in Adams on Feb. 16, 1938, daughter of Albert A. and Irene Brousso Duprey, she attended Adams schools, including the former Notre Dame Parochial School, and was a pro merito graduate of the former Adams High School in 1955.
She had resided in Springfield for several years and was employed by Westvaco Corp. from 1965 until 1986. She moved to North Adams in 1987 and was employed by several area attorneys as a legal secretary, specializing in real estate, until her retirement in 2000. She also was employed as a licensed real estate agent and was a notary public.
She enjoyed working on detailed crafts, and had built dollhouses. She also enjoyed quilting and sewing.
